NAME
xcb_glx_destroy_pixmap -
SYNOPSIS
#include <xcb/glx.h> Request function xcb_void_cookie_t xcb_glx_destroy_pixmap(xcb_connection_t *conn, xcb_glx_pixmap_t glx_pixmap);
REQUEST ARGUMENTS
conn The XCB connection to X11. glx_pixmap TODO: NOT YET DOCUMENTED.
DESCRIPTION
RETURN VALUE
Returns an xcb_void_cookie_t. Errors (if any) have to be handled in the event loop. If you want to handle errors directly with xcb_request_check instead, use xcb_glx_destroy_pixmap_checked. See xcb-requests(3) for details.
ERRORS
This request does never generate any errors.
